Expert Analysis
If you need cash quickly, Fairstone allows you to borrow between $500 and $60,000 with terms ranging from 6 to 120 months. Their application process is straightforward, with funds potentially available on the same day. However, interest rates start at 29.99%, which may result in high repayment costs over time.
Unlike other lenders, Fairstone specializes in unsecured loans, meaning no collateral is required. This can be beneficial for those who do not want to risk their assets. Yet, the high APR means this option might not be ideal for individuals with existing debt or those who may struggle with payments.
The company promises no application fees and no pre-payment penalties, allowing borrowers to pay off their loans early without incurring additional costs. For those who qualify, the approval process is generally quick, but individuals with lower credit scores may face challenges.
In comparison to other lenders like Borrowell or Mogo, Fairstone's rates can be significantly higher, making it crucial for borrowers to evaluate their options carefully.
